Finally crashed!
After 13 months, 16K miles, and 5.01 trackdays of riding, I finally lowsided. 1st session, 4th lap at Thunderhill, I lowsided off of Turn 9. Can't blame anything but myself. Don't exactly know what happened though. Didn't go into the turn saying "oh shoot, going too fast" or anything like that. Just did what I always do and next thing I know, my head slammed the ground going anywhere from 50-70mph.
Damage to my F2- front fairing stay bent up. Anyone have a spare they want to sell? Track plastics took some beating, but thats why I bought them. Money well spent!! Frame sliders and bar ends did their jobs too.
Damage to gear- KBC TK-9 took a good hit, but did its job well. My helimot suit took some scratches and scuffs, but no road rash. Not even a bruise on the hip. Money well spent!! Alpinestar GP pro gloves did their job cause you can see the area where I slid my hand on the pavement. Alpinestar SMX-plus took a slight beating on the toe sliders, but no biggie.
After a decent spill, I have no road rash or broken bones. Just a sore neck and chest. My gear might have cost $3000, but it sure beats the pain of taking a shower with road rash or physical therapy after you break a bone.
I know alot of you have crashed wearing minimal gear and sustained minimal injuries, but please consider upgrading your gear before your bike. Instead of upgrading to an $8K 600RR with only $500 in protective gear, consider keeping that early 90's $2K bike and buying that $1K leather suit and those $250 boots. Thats what I did and I feel like that stuff paid for itself.
